Categories : Italian | Pasta | Halal

 
Ordered Meatballs (Beef) at Pastamania. And yes! Pastamania again.
The dish consists of six flam-grilled meatballs in tomato herb sauce; the spaghetti is cooked nicely, whereby I can taste the original spaghetti taste and it is not soggy.
There are very generous with their servings! However, some of the meatballs are overcooked.

Categories : Italian | Pasta | Halal

I have ordered a dory baked rice at Pastamania plus combo A; the dory fish baked rice was served in tomato herb sauce with creamy sauce and gratinated with mozzarella cheese. The whole dish was a bit bland, and I could hardly taste the dory fish.
Combo A consists of a soup that I have chosen Minestrone Soup and three slices of Garlic Bread and drink. The soup was fantastic, it is a tomatoes based soup with varies kinds of vegetables added such as carrot and celery.

Categories : Japanese | Sushi/Sashimi

Dine in at Watami- Bishan.
We ordered a Mentai potato pizza- taste similarly like Hawaii pizza. The base is tomatoes paste and roe cod fish, it has a strong fish smell, salty and looks like bacon. It is delicious. i am able to taste and smell the seafood. Base is thin crust and crispy, and I am able to taste the pizza bread. The serving was just nice, six pieces of pizza was just nice for a family of four to order

Categories : Singaporean | Food Court | Zi Char | Fine Dining | Brunch

Bought a Bandung drink and it is so chilly which makes it a great drink for warm days
Bandung is a drink that has milk flavoured with rose cordial syrup and this gives their unique colour appearance, pink. However, the drink taste very sweet which is not suitable for diabetics patient.
